Syntheses, characterization and luminescence of Pt-M (M = Re, Ru, Gd) heteronuclear complexes with 5-ethynyl-2,2 '-bipyridine

Incorporation of diplatinum component [Pt-2(mu-dppm)(2)(C Cbpy)(4)] (1, dppm = Ph2PCH2PPh2, C Cbpy = 2,2'-dipyridyl-5-acetylide) with Re(CO)(5)Cl, Ru(bpy)(2)Cl-2 (bpy = 2,2'-bipyridine) and Gd(hfac)(3)(H2O)(2) (Hhfac = hexafluoroacetylacetone) via 2,2'-dipyridyl chelating induced isolation of (Pt2Ru4II)-Ru-II (2), (Pt2Ru4II)-Ru-II (3), and (Pt2Gd2III)-Gd-II (4) complexes, respectively. The structures of 2 and 4 were determined by X-ray single crystal diffraction. Intense low-energy absorptions occur in the range 360-510 nm originating from metal-to-ligand charge transfer (MLCT) transitions. These compounds display photoluminescence in both solid states and dichloromethane at room temperature with emissive lifetimes in the range of microseconds. (c) 2006 Elsevier B.V.
